Position Summary The Lot Attendant is a self-motivated, punctual, and reliable individual with a strong work ethic and willingness to take initiative. The primary responsibility is to meet various deadlines for vehicle detailing and transportation, while remaining adaptable to changing circumstances. Key Responsibilities Receive, move and park vehicles in assigned areas Drive customers to their point of destination Inspect vehicles for damage Clean, vacuum, and shampoo vehicles Maintain an organized and clean work environment Assist in the general maintenance of the dealership Technical Skills & Requirements Valid BC driver’s licence class 5 is required with a clean driver’s abstract Full-time availability, including shifts during days, evenings and weekends, based on operating hours.
